Write the equation of the line (in point-slope form) that passes through the point (3, -4) and has a slope of 6.
rosijanka [135]

Answer:

y+4=6(x-3)

Step-by-step explanation:

y-y1=m(x-x1)

y-(-4)=6(x-3)

y+4=6(x-3)
